Technology is rapidly improving in the electric vehicle industry. Battery technology is getting better, making it possible for electric vehicles to travel longer distances on a single charge. The range of many electric vehicles now exceeds 300 miles, making them practical for everyday use.
Charging stations are also becoming more widespread. Major cities and highways are being equipped with fast chargers, allowing drivers to charge their vehicles quickly. Some EVs can charge to 80% in about 30 minutes, making long trips more feasible.

Despite the growth in charging stations, the infrastructure is not yet as widespread as gas stations. In rural areas, finding a charging station can still be a challenge. This can make long-distance travel more complicated for electric vehicle owners.
Range anxiety is the fear of running out of battery before reaching a charging station. While most electric vehicles now offer a practical range, some drivers worry about being stranded. Continued expansion of charging stations and improvements in battery technology are helping to alleviate these concerns.
Although the cost of electric vehicles is decreasing, they can still be more expensive than traditional cars. This can be a barrier for many consumers, especially those on tight budgets. As technology continues to improve and production scales up, prices are expected to come down further.
While electric vehicles help reduce emissions during use, there are concerns about the environmental impact of battery production. Mining for lithium, cobalt, and other materials needed for batteries can have negative effects on the environment. Finding sustainable ways to produce batteries and recycling them after their life cycle is an ongoing challenge in the industry.
